NASHVILLE, Tenn. — Three weeks ago, Tennessee's chances of signing Maplewood lineman James Stone appeared slim.
But once Derek Dooley was hired to replace Lane Kiffin, the Volunteers' stock soared quickly.
Stone picked Tennessee over Alabama, the national champion, on Wednesday as ESPNU televised the proceedings from a crowded lecture hall at Maplewood.
"Tennessee didn't seem like a place where I would feel comfortable (under Kiffin), but now I feel like I will be comfortable with the leadership and I'll be able to really grow as a person," Stone said. "(Dooley's staff) seems more down to earth, more genuine people. I feel better taking coaching from them because they're going to be coaching and guiding me for the next four years."
